BNB Chain Takes Legal Action Against Ex-Employee Over Unauthorized Memecoin Issuance
BNB Chain is taking legal action against a former employee who allegedly issued an unauthorized token after leaving the company. The incident occurred when the ex-employee accessed a wallet's seed phrase without authorization, generated a new private key, and used it to create a memecoin.
The token in question has no affiliation with BNB Chain and was not created or supported by the company, according to an official statement on X. The firm emphasized that users should exercise caution when dealing with cryptocurrencies and urged them to rely on official announcements and verified sources before engaging with any project.
The incident highlights the potential risks associated with insider access and the importance of securing sensitive information, even after an employee's departure. BNB Chain is working with relevant authorities to address the situation and may set a precedent for how similar cases are handled in the crypto space.
